How to Load It Properly

1. Put the Vehicle Where the Weight Belongs

The vehicle is not just another piece of cargo. It is the heaviest thing in the trailer, so it has to be positioned first and positioned correctly. Load it so you maintain proper tongue weight and keep the trailer balanced. Nick can walk you through the setup at pickup if you tell him what vehicle you are hauling.

2. Use the Remaining Floor for Dense, Stable Cargo

Once the vehicle is positioned, the remaining space can take boxes, totes, tools, coolers, parts, and smaller furniture. Dense items stay low. Nothing loose. Nothing stacked so high that it can topple into the vehicle during braking.

3. Protect the Vehicle From Your Own Cargo

This is where the included moving blankets matter. If you're loading furniture, totes, or metal parts around a vehicle, every contact point should be padded. The point of enclosed transport is not just getting the car there — it's getting it there without dings and scratches from your own stuff shifting inside the trailer.

4. Use the E-Track Like You Mean It

The trailer has 20 E-track tie-down points. Use them. Strap the vehicle separately from the cargo. Strap cargo into zones. Do not think of a full trailer as one giant pile. Think of it as several independent secured sections.

Important: The right use case is a vehicle plus organized cargo — not filling every cubic inch with random furniture around a car until nothing can move. If the load plan sounds chaotic, split the trip.

When It Is Not the Right Move

Don't force this trailer into jobs it is not meant for. If your tow vehicle is marginal, if the vehicle being loaded is oversized, or if your household load is so large that you're trying to pack wall-to-wall around a car, it may be smarter to use two trips or a different setup. That's not a failure — it's just load planning.
